Chapter 84: Weight of Solitude
Not long after Liam left the office and entered the lobby, the field agents who had departed earlier that morning returned, including Team C. They had apparently completed an evacuation mission, after a faction had successfully dealt with a monster that had emerged through a breach.
The idle chatter of Team C filled the lobby as they filed in from their mission, but it was Sarah’s distinct and obvious voice that caught Liam’s attention, causing him to turn in their direction. Sarah spotted him almost immediately, and the others followed her gaze as she called out, “Hey, hotshot’s back!”
They approached Liam with the easy familiarity of teammates even though they actually weren’t. Sarah was the first to speak, her tone carrying its usual blend of sarcasm and genuine interest. “So how did your first special mission go?”
Liam offered a wry smile in response, not knowing how to approach Sarah’s sarcastic question.
“Hey,” Elaine said softly, with this smile of hers that was warm and welcoming.
“Hey,” Liam replied, matching her gentle tone. Amir stepped forward, backing up Sarah’s inquiry with his own curiosity. “Yeah, man, tell us how it went. Also, let me know what you think of Team A—we know the mission was with them too.”
There was more than casual interest in his voice; Amir genuinely wanted to know how skilled USOV’s top team really was. Silas remained characteristically quiet, though he shared the same expectant mood as the rest of the group.
“It was a successful mission, all thanks to Quinn,” Liam said simply, offering nothing more.
The others stared at him, clearly expecting additional details. Then this awkward silence stretched for another two seconds before Sarah broke it. “Wait, just that?” she asked, with that look on her face that resembled a frown.
Liam’s face flushed with embarrassment. “Is there something else I’m supposed to say after that?”
“Oh, come on, man!” Sarah exclaimed, throwing her hands up in exasperated resignation. She had expected so much more.
“Liam, my friend, you are no fun,” Amir added, placing his hand on Liam’s shoulder with mock disappointment. He too had hoped for more details about the story as well.
Team C had never been selected for a special mission expedition, and it seemed like only Team A was enjoying that privilege so far. Elaine struggled to contain her laughter as she watched her teammates’ poor reaction to Liam’s lackluster storytelling.
Sensing the need to change the subject, Liam’s expression grew serious. “Guys, I have to tell you something. I’m going to look for Yaela.”
Immediately, the laughter ceased and the entire group became somber. “Do you know where to look?” Amir asked at once.
“Yeah,” Sarah added, leaning forward with concern.
“I may have some idea where,” Liam replied carefully.
“Then let us come with you,” Elaine said without hesitation, and the others nodded in unanimous agreement, but Liam shook his head. “I’m sorry, guys, but this is going to be a solo thing.”
“What? Don’t be silly, We are coming with you, hotshot,” Sarah declared, her tone brooking no argument.
“Let us help—we want to,” Elaine added earnestly. “We worry about Yaela too.”
The others nodded affirmatively at Elaine’s words, their expressions resolute.
However, Liam sighed deeply, and said “I know, and I appreciate that, but what I’m trying to get into is too dangerous. I can’t risk putting anyone else in harm’s way.”
Then Silas, who had been silent throughout the exchange, stepped forward. “You’re always trying to take everything on alone, like when you fought all those middleweight challengers back then.” He chuckled at the memory, and Liam scratched his head with a wry smile.
Silas continued, “But this is different right now. It’s not the midnight circuit, and yes, you’re powerful, but even the strongest people in this world need help sometimes.”
Sarah immediately seized on this rare moment of eloquence from their usually quiet teammate. “You see? You made old man Silas speak more words than he has in the last week!”
Everyone burst into laughter, momentarily forgetting the serious nature of their conversation. “Hey! Not fair!” Silas protested, his face reddening a bit with embarrassment.
When Liam recovered from his laughter, his expression slowly grew serious again. “Look, guys, the only way you can help me here is by staying here and staying alive.”
Elaine sighed, and with voice caring this quiet understanding, she said. “It’s fine, Liam, but know this, if you ever need us, we’ll be here to offer all the help we can.”
“Yeah, hotshot,” Sarah added, her usual bravado softened by genuine concern. Amir and Silas nodded in affirmation, their support clear even in their silence.
With a grateful smile, Liam said, “Thank you.”
